MATTER OF THOMS


9 A.D.2d 186 (1959)

In the Matter of the Intermediate Accounting of The Security Trust Company of Rochester, as Trustee of a Trust Made by Charles M. Thoms and Others, Respondent. Janet T. Ingersoll, Appellant. (And Seven Other Proceedings.)

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Fourth Department.

November 13,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Forsyth, Gianning & Middleton (C. Benn Forsyth of counsel), for appellant.

Moser, Johnson & Reif (Richard G. Crawford of counsel), for respondent.

All concur. Present — McCURN, P. J., KIMBALL, WILLIAMS, BASTOW and HALPERN, JJ.


Per Curiam.

These consolidated proceedings were brought in Supreme Court for the judicial settlement of the several intermediate accounts of the respondent trustee pursuant to the provisions of article 79 of the Civil Practice Act. Seven of the accountings relate to inter vivos trusts and the eighth to a testamentary trust.
